Auth bypass in Sap_se Sap Netweaver Application Server For Abap And Platform

CVE-2024-44114

SAP NetWeaver Application Server for ABAP and ABAP Platform allow users with high privileges to execute a program that reveals data over the network. This results in a minimal impact on confidentiality of the application.

Vulnerability class: Broken Access Control

CVSS v3 base score 2.0 (Low).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:H/UI:R/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N.
